The Big Hugs Elmo is truly one of the neatest stuffed toys I’ve seen, it’s no wonder it also got the PTPA sign of approval. He reacts based on how he is held, he keeps children engaged by saying over 50 phrases, singing songs, dreaming up scenarios encouraging imaginary play. What I though was the sweetest was when he is placed on his back, in the laying position, he winds down for bed, singing lullaby’s and making soothing sounds, encouraging sleep.
